Does your antivirus regularly report about the “Remoexpa”?

If you have seen a message indicating the “H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B found”, then it’s a piece of good information! The malware “H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B” was found as well as, most likely, erased. Such messages do not indicate that there was an actually active Remoexpa on your device. You could have merely downloaded a documents that contained H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B, so your antivirus software application instantly deleted it prior to it was introduced and created the difficulties. Alternatively, the destructive manuscript on the contaminated internet site might have been discovered and avoided prior to triggering any type of issues.

Simply put, the message “H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B Found” during the typical use your computer system does not mean that the Remoexpa has actually finished its objective. If you see such a message then maybe the evidence of you visiting the infected web page or filling the harmful file. Attempt to prevent it in the future, however do not worry too much. Trying out opening the antivirus program and also inspecting the H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B detection log documents. This will provide you more information concerning what the precise Remoexpa was detected as well as what was specifically done by your antivirus software program with it. 🤔 How Do I Know My Windows 10 PC Has HackTool:Win32/Remoexpa.RS!MTB?
There are many ways to tell if your Windows 10 computer has been infected. Some of the warning signs include: Computer is very slow. Applications take too long to start. Computer keeps crashing. Your friends receive spam messages from you on social media. You see a new extension that you did not install on your Chrome browser. Internet connection is slower than usual.
🤔 How to scan my PC with Microsoft Defender?
Most of the time, Microsoft Defender will neutralize threats before they ever become a problem. If this is the case, you can see past threat reports in the Windows Security app. Open Windows Settings. The easiest way is to click the start button and then the gear icon. Alternately, you can press the Windows key + i on your keyboard.
